the measure of the angle is 88 degrees greater than its complement. what is the measure of the complement?

Let the angle be x and it's complement be c.

Then, x = c + 88 and x + c = 90

Substitute the first equation in the second.

(c+88) + c = 90
2c+88 = 90
2c = 2
c =1

Compliment = 1
Angle = 89
